>>>>> "GS" == Greg Stark <gsstark@mit.edu> writes:

GS> I put a From header in the message because I wanted to send it from an
GS> address other than my default. This is how emacs MUAs always
GS> worked. I'm pretty sure message-mode used to work with these
GS> too. However this time it stuck two From headers in, which is really
GS> evil, and probably a violation of some RFCs, at least the GNKSA.

GS> This may be related to having an address element in my ".*" posting style. 

It isn't part of the posting style code.  This code is specifically
designed to override duplicate entries, as per the info node '(gnus)Posting
Styles'.  This also happens as your *message* buffer is being generated, so
you can correct any errors.

Is it possible that you have something inserting a From line in your
message-header-setup-hook, message-send-hook or one of the dozen other
message-mode hooks?
